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Plant: Larger plants or trees typically cost more to remove due to the increased labor and equipment required.
- Accessibility: If the plant is in a hard-to-reach area, such as a backyard with limited access, the cost may increase.
- Type of Plant: Different plants have varying root systems and structures, which can influence the complexity and cost of removal.
- Condition of the Plant: A plant that is already partially decomposed may be easier and cheaper to remove than one that is still standing but dead.
- Disposal Fees: Costs can vary depending on how the plant material needs to be disposed of, whether it's hauled away or chipped on-site.
- Permits and Regulations: In some cases, local regulations may require permits for removing certain types of plants, adding to the overall c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(San Rafael, CA) |
---|---|
Small Shrub Removal | $50 - $100 |
Medium Bush Removal | $100 - $200 |
Large Tree Removal | $500 - $1,500 |
Stump Grinding | $100 - $300 |
Hauling Away Debris | $50 - $150 |
On-Site Chipping | $75 - $200 |
